概述
TPWallet的“观察钱包”(watch-only wallet)作为一种只读钱包形态,在不暴露私钥的前提下为用户和组织提供账户监控、交易审核与链上数据可视化。本文从安全交流、高科技数字化转型、专家洞察、交易失败原因、区块链不可篡改性与高级身份认证六个维度,解析观察钱包在当前生态中的角色与实操建议。
一、观察钱包与安全交流
观察钱包本身不持有私钥,因此在防止私钥泄露方面是一道天然的防线。但其安全性仍依赖于通信链路与显示端的完整性。安全交流要点包括:
- 端到端加密:观察钱包与后端节点或浏览器插件之间必须采用TLS+证书固定(certificate pinning)或更高安全协议,防止中间人攻击(MITM)。
- 签名隔离:任何需要签名的操作应在硬件钱包或隔离签名设备上完成,观察钱包仅负责构建并展示交易数据。
- 可审计日志:保持不可篡改的访问与操作日志,便于事后审计与溯源。
二、高科技数字化转型的价值与挑战
在企业上链与流程数字化方面,观察钱包是低摩擦的入口:它能将链上资产、合约事件与内部系统(如KYC/AML、ERP)连接起来,支持实时监控与告警。但转型挑战也明显:跨链数据一致性、链下治理与隐私保护、以及合规与监管适配。建议采用分层架构:链上状态+链下策略层+统一监控面板,以兼顾效率与合规。
三、专家洞察与治理建议
专家普遍认为观察钱包适合用于多方协作场景(审计、合规、托管监控)与研发测试环境。治理建议包括:
- 权限最小化:为不同团队与角色分配只读视图或更细粒度的过滤权限。
- 多方审计:定期导出链上活动快照,与内部账本核对,使用不可篡改存证(如Merkle树或时间戳服务)锁定证据。
- 事件响应:制定针对可疑转出或异常交互的响应流程,并保证可在观察层快速触发多方确认或冻结操作(通过链上多签合约实现)。

四、交易失败的主因与诊断方法
尽管观察钱包不签发交易,但它参与交易构建与预览,能显著降低失败率。常见失败原因与对应诊断方法:
- Gas设置不当或网络拥堵:通过实时链上费率API与重试策略调整gas price/gas limit。
- Nonce冲突或重复签名:提供最新的nonce查询并在构建交易时做序列化控制。
- 链ID或合约地址错误:在观察界面加入链ID与合约校验步骤,避免跨链误操作。
- 签名算法或参数不匹配:在提交前做本地签名模拟(模拟验签)以确保签名格式正确。
- 合约逻辑失败(revert):在发送前通过节点或仿真器执行一次“静态调用”以捕获revert原因。
五、不可篡改性与现实限制
区块链提供了强健的不可篡改记录,但这一特性仅在链上状态与数据被正确提交且多数节点达成共识时成立。观察钱包可以作为透明窗口,记录与展示这些证据。但需注意:
- 链下数据与元数据仍可被修改,需借助链上哈希存证或第三方时间戳服务固定证明。
- 节点被攻破或供应链攻击可能导致错误数据被传播,建议采用多源节点验证与跨节点比对机制。
六、高级身份认证与隐私保护
观察钱包在权限控制与身份认证上应引入更高等级保护:

- 多因子与强认证:结合硬件安全模块(HSM)、FIDO2/WebAuthn 与一次性密码,提升访问保护。
- 去中心化身份(DID)与凭证:集成DID与可验证凭证(VC),在链下用于KYC并在链上保留不可识别的证明指纹。
- 零知识证明(ZKP):在需要证明合规而不泄露敏感数据时,可使用ZKP技术证明某些断言(如余额上限、合规性)而不透露具体数据。
结论与最佳实践
观察钱包是连接链上透明性与链下治理的桥梁。要发挥其最大价值,必须在安全交流、身份认证、审计可追溯性与故障诊断上形成闭环:采用端到端加密与隔离签名、引入多源节点与链上存证、在交易提交前进行充分的仿真与校验、并将DID/ZKP等新兴技术纳入访问与合规框架。通过这些手段,TPWallet观察钱包既能保护资产安全,又能推动组织的高科技数字化转型。
评论
CryptoCat
文章把观察钱包的安全边界讲得很清楚,特别是隔离签名和证书固定的建议,实用性强。
李明
关于交易失败的诊断方法很有帮助,静态调用和nonce控制是我们团队需要立刻落地的措施。
SatoshiFan
推荐把DID和ZKP结合到观察钱包的访问控制里,这能很好地平衡合规与隐私。
小雨
希望能看到更多关于多源节点验证的实现细节,比如如何做跨节点比对与异常检测。